-
SQLBETWEEN运算符:高效筛选数据SQL的BETWEEN运算符是用于筛选特定数据范围的利器,能够快速定位介于两个值之间的记录,这些值可以是数字、日期或文本(取决于数据库的排序规则)。语法SELECTcolumn1,column2,...FROMtable_nameWHEREcolumn_nameBETWEENvalue1ANDvalue2;BETWEEN子句包含上下限值(value1和value2),且包含边界值。工作原理BETWEEN运算符的工作方式如下:数值范围筛选:用于提取列值在指定数值范围内
-
避免“时间戳浩劫”:优化大数据量日期查询面对海量表数据和非索引时间戳字段,查询性能下降是一个常见的...
-
MySQL...
-
MySQL中WHERE子句同时使用多个字段的锁机制在MySQL中,UPDATE语句可以通过WHERE...
-
在不同表中找到一对多关系中的最新记录问题:如何快速高效地从两张表中获取一对多关系的最新记录?子查询...
-
如何处理Redis中的大key?针对任务数据实时保存需求,在任务开始时,每5秒将数据保存到Redis的list...
-
Protobuf对MySQL驱动的依赖MySQL驱动包中依赖Protobuf的原因是MySQL8.0...
-
数据库任务并发执行的队列读取问题在数据库中有20个任务,需要5个线程并发执行这些任务。执行流程为:读取...
-
高效数据上传的设计在离线服务器上运行的程序定期需要将本地数据库中的数据同步至云服务器中的数据库。现...
-
如何获取MySQL实例的Binlog文件和偏移量以及停止Slave状态想要获取MySQL实例当前binlog...
-
where子句同时使用多个字段锁表还是锁行在MySQL中使用UPDATE语句时,where子句中使用了两个字段(id和is_delete),�...
-
企业更换系统,例如升级人力资源管理系统(HRMS),常常面临巨大挑战,尤其是在最大限度减少停机时间方面。本文将通过一个真实案例,阐述一家顶级人力资源服务公司如何利用数据迁移工具无缝替换其HRMS系统。业务架构与需求该公司旨在用功能更强大的新HRMS系统取代旧系统。旧系统涵盖员工合同、薪资、社保和办公地点等信息管理。新系统需要处理更多数据,因此需要重建系统中的数据存储。技术架构与数据迁移策略旧系统基于Oracle数据库,新系统采用MySQL数据库。为了确保在系统替换期间HR服务的持续性,并应对网络复杂性以及
-
利用地理空间技术高效处理700万条记录并创建交互式地图本文探讨如何使用Laravel和MySQL高效处理超过700万条记录,并将其转换为可交互的地图可视化。初始挑战项目需求:利用MySQL数据库中700万条记录,提取有价值的见解。许多人首先考虑编程语言,却忽略了数据库本身:它能否满足需求?是否需要数据迁移或结构调整?MySQL能否承受如此大的数据负载?初步分析:需要确定关键过滤器和属性。经过分析,发现仅少数属性与解决方案相关。我们验证了过滤器的可行性,并设置了一些限制来优化搜索。地图搜索基于城
-
比较表结构并生成变更脚本的工具在数据库开发中,经常需要比较不同版本之间的表结构变化。为了简化这一任...
-
在SQL中使用IFTEST判断字段是否在列表中在场景中,需要进行批量更新,其中变量fieldNamesList...